How We Keep Soole Along Safe
Driver Verification
Every driver on Soole Along submits their NIN, driver's licence, and vehicle documentation before they can post a trip. An administrator reviews and approves each driver before they appear on the platform or can accept bookings. Drivers who don't pass verification, or whose documents appear fraudulent, are rejected.
Trip Transparency
When a driver starts a trip, passengers with an active booking on that trip are notified. Trip status (Scheduled, In Transit, Completed) is visible to both parties throughout.
What Soole Along Does Not Currently Provide
To be transparent: we do not currently offer live GPS tracking of a driver's real-time location during a trip, or 24/7 emergency response monitoring. If you need help during a trip, contact Nigeria's emergency services directly, and let us know afterward via sooleandalong@gmail.com so we can review the trip.
Reporting a Concern
If you experience unsafe behaviour from a driver or passenger, or suspect fraudulent documentation, report it to sooleandalong@gmail.com with the trip details. We investigate all reports and may suspend accounts pending review.
Tips for Passengers
Confirm the driver's name, car colour, and plate number match your booking before entering the vehicle. Share your trip details with someone you trust before you travel.
Tips for Drivers
Confirm passenger identity matches the booking before departure. Keep your vehicle documents and emergency contact information up to date in your profile.
